#ff98d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ff98d5 is composed of 100% red, 59.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 324.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 79.8%. #ff98d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ff31ab.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#ff98d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ff98d5 has RGB values of R:255, G:152,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.16, K:0. Its decimal value is 16750805.

Shades and Tints of #ff98d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0009 is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ff98d5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fc8cc is the less saturated color, while #ff98d5 is the most saturated one.
